Statement by Members of the International Law Association Committee on the Use of Force
Members of the ILA Committee on the Use of Force, in which Dr. Beham is a representative of the ILA Austrian Branch, have issued a statement available in almost 30 languages assessing the events in Ukraine from an international law perspective: https://www.justsecurity.org/80454/statement-by-members-of-the-international-law-association-committee-on-the-use-of-force/ Apart from recognising the violation of international law by Russia, it emphasises the clear obligations of the international community in relation to peremptory norms of international law, namely to cooperate to bring the aggression to an end through lawful means, not to recognise as lawful any situation it creates, or render any aid or assistance in maintaining the situation (which may consist in economic support of Russia).
